Pakistani actor and director Yasir Hussain has once again found himself at the center of a social media storm after making controversial remarks about polygamy and the role of women in marriages. His comments, made during a recent television show, have sparked widespread criticism, with many users expressing their dissatisfaction over his views on women.

In a candid discussion about the institution of marriage, Yasir stated that he personally does not support polygamy and that he believes in marrying the person he loves. He emphasized that the idea of marrying another woman does not appeal to him. However, his comments took a turn when he explained that, in his view, the responsibility for a man’s second marriage often lies with women.

“I am not in favor of four marriages,” Yasir said during the show. “I married the person I loved, and now the idea of looking at another woman doesn’t even cross my mind.”

But he then proceeded to elaborate, stating that women play a significant role when a man enters into a second marriage. “If a man gets married again, women have a bigger role to play,” he explained. “Today’s women want to marry financially stable men who can provide for them, take care of their children, and offer a comfortable life. When they see such men, they are willingly ready to become the second wife.”

The actor continued by sharing personal experiences, mentioning that he knows women who, despite knowing that the man is already married, still willingly enter into relationships with them. In some cases, he claimed, these women even attempt to have the first wife divorced.

Yasir’s remarks on social media quickly attracted a wave of criticism, with many questioning his views on women. While some individuals agreed with his perspective and saw it as a reflection of reality, a larger portion of the audience condemned his comments for being patriarchal and unfair to women.

Critics on social media pointed out that the burden of blame for polygamous marriages should not solely be placed on women. They argued that men who engage in such practices also share the responsibility and should be held accountable for their actions. Many users expressed their anger at Yasir’s generalization of women’s role in marriages, accusing him of blaming women for a problem that is rooted in societal norms and male behavior.

While some defended him, suggesting that Yasir was merely highlighting a common issue in modern-day relationships, the backlash was overwhelming. Social media platforms quickly filled with posts condemning his statements, and many called for a more respectful and equitable discussion about relationships and marriage.

Yasir Hussain, known for his candidness and sometimes provocative statements, has previously stirred controversy with similar remarks. Despite the backlash, he remains unapologetic, often asserting that his views are rooted in his personal experiences and observations.
